When growing flowers at home, you should also pay attention to safety. When growing flowers on balconies and platforms, some people place potted flowers on balconies and windowsills, and some build simple flower stands. These places to place flower pots are not safe. If you are not careful or the wind blows them down, they can easily injure pedestrians. Therefore, friends should also pay attention to safety when growing flowers. You should always pay attention to the placement of potted flowers and regularly inspect self-built flower stands to prevent flower pots from falling and causing injury. Friends, some people are worried that placing plants indoors for a long time will affect human health. In fact, this is unnecessary worry. During the day, plants carry out photosynthesis and release far more oxygen than they need. Although most plants stop photosynthesis at night, their breathing is weak. In particular, foliage plants breathe more weakly than flowering plants and require less oxygen. But did you know that flowering plants need more oxygen when they are growing and blooming? Someone once did an experiment; the amount of oxygen needed to light a match is equivalent to the amount of oxygen breathed in two or three pots of indoor plants in the room in one night. It can be seen that the carbon dioxide exhaled by ornamental plants is negligible. Therefore, indoor plants have no effect on human health. On the contrary, many plants are beneficial to the human body. For example, plants of Bromeliaceae, Cactaceae, and Crassulaceae will not release carbon dioxide into the room whether it is day or night, and will even absorb carbon dioxide at night. Plants such as Begonia, Asparagus Fern, and Asparagus Codonopsis (also known as Wuzhu) can not only absorb carbon dioxide, but also secrete bactericidal substances. Plants can also reduce indoor dust, clean the air, and allow you to live in a fresh environment.
